Karma and Dharma: A Tale of Arjuna and Krishna
In the hallowed halls within Mahabharata, we witness the profound interplay between karma and dharma. Arjuna, the valiant warrior, stands at a crossroads. His duty, his dharma, compels him to wield his arrows against his own kin.
Overwhelmed by this internal struggle, Arjuna seeks counsel from his charioteer, Krishna, who is none other than Lord Vishnu himself. Krishna's teachings unveil the profound nature of karma and dharma, revealing that actions have consequences.
He illuminates that Arjuna's duty lies not in choosing sides but in completing his dharma in righteousness. Through Krishna's wisdom, Arjuna finds peace, understanding that true victory lies not in conquest but in living a virtuous life.
Their timeless dialogue lives on as a potent reminder concerning the significance of karma and dharma in our own lives.
